The letter shin appears engraved on both sides of the head- tefilin.On the right side, the shin possesses three heads, while on the left side it … Web1 Feb 2024 · Shin splints are a common name people use to describe gradual onset pain at the front and inside of the lower leg. However, it is not a specific injury or diagnosis itself. There are a number of injuries that cause shin splints type pain: Medial tibial stress syndrome Medial tibial stress syndrome is the most common cause of inside shin pain.

It will include both the official … WebThe tibia is the larger of the two bones in the lower leg. It is also known as the shin bone. Internal tibial torsion is an inward twisting of the tibia, which leads to in-toeing of the foot. Although it may not be noticeable until your child starts to walk, this condition is often present since birth. Internal tibial torsion usually affects ...
